3. Noilly Prat Extra Dry: The French Heritage
For the Martini purest, Noilly Prat is the Leica lens. It’s sharp, dry, and focused. It has been aged outdoors in oak casks, giving it a salt-kissed, prestigious finish that vibrates with Luminous Precision.

"In my 2026 mixology sessions from London to NYC, I tell my clients that Vermouth is the 'Invisible Anchor' of a cocktail. You can use the most expensive gin, but if your Vermouth is an afterthought, the 'Gilded Aura' of the drink evaporates. My top secret? Always keep your Vermouth in the fridge. It’s a fortified wine, and it needs to stay fresh to maintain its 'Luminous Precision'.
